What Are Cookies?
Cookies are small text files that websites place on your device (computer, tablet, or mobile) when you visit them. They help websites remember information about your visit, making your next visit easier and more useful.
Similar Technologies
We also use similar technologies including:
- • Local Storage: Stores data locally in your browser
- • Session Storage: Temporary storage that expires when you close your browser
- • Web Beacons: Small tracking pixels for analytics
- • Pixel Tags: Help us understand email engagement
